History

The use of Isophorone as a solvent resulted from the search for ways to dispose of or recycle acetone, which is a waste product of phenol synthesis by the Hock method.

Uses

 Isophorone (CAS NO.78-59-1) is used as a solvent in some printing inks, paints, lacquers, adhesives, copolymers, coatings, finishings and pesticides.[2] It is also used as a chemical intermediate and as an ingredient in wood preservatives and floor sealants.

Safety Profile

Moderately toxic by ingestion. Mildly toxic by inhalation. Human systemic effects by inhalation: olfactory changes, conjunctiva irritation, and respiratory changes. Human systemic irritant by inhalation. A skin and severe eye irritant. Questionable carcinogen with experimental carcinogenic data. Mutation data reported. Considered to be more toxic than mesityl oxide. However, due to its low volatility, it is not a dangerous industrial hazard. The response of guinea pigs and rats to repeated inhalation of the vapors indicates that it is one of the most toxic of the ketones. It is chiefly a kidney poison. It can cause irritation, lachrymation, possible opacity of the cornea, and necrosis of the cornea (experimental). It is irritating at the level of 25 ppm to humans. In animal experiments death during exposure was usually due to narcosis, but occasionally due to irritation of the lungs. Flammable and explosive when exposed to heat or flame; can react with oxidizing materials. To fight fire, use foam, CO2, dry chemical.

Standards and Recommendations

OSHA PEL: TWA 4 ppm
ACGIH TLV: CL 5 ppm
DFG MAK: 2 ppm (11 mg/m3)
NIOSH REL: TWA (Ketones) 23 mg/m3

Analytical Methods

For occupational chemical analysis use NIOSH: Isophorone, 2508.
